    In this episode of the Perpetually Overdue Podcast, we delve into the therapeutic aspects of romance novels, discussing how these stories serve as emotional support and coping mechanisms for readers. We explore the resurgence of the romance genre, particularly through platforms like TikTok and BookTok, and how it has become a safe space for processing emotions and experiences.

    Desiree shares her personal journey, highlighting how romance books provided solace during difficult times, while Heather offers a contrasting perspective as a reader primarily of horror and fantasy.

    Together, we emphasize the importance of happy endings in romance novels and how they contribute to emotional regulation and escapism for readers.

    In this episode of the Perpetually Overdue Podcast, we explore the concept of stepping into one's 'villain era' as a form of self-love and empowerment. We discuss the importance of being 'unbothered' in a world that often pressures individuals to conform to societal expectations.

    The conversation emphasizes the significance of setting boundaries, taking up space, and embracing individuality while navigating the challenges that come with asserting oneself.

    We share personal anecdotes and practical tips for listeners to cultivate their own unbothered mindset and live authentically without the weight of others' opinions.

    In this episode of the Perpetually Overdue Podcast, though we will trigger diehard Swifties, this is too important to us not to discuss, especially as ex-Swifties.

    We delve into our personal histories as fans, where the decline began, and the impact of her recent work. We discuss the evolution of Swift's image, the disconnect between her celebrity status and the realities faced by her audience, and the implications of her political silence.


    The conversation highlights the importance of accountability in celebrity culture and encourages listeners to reflect on their support for artists in light of social justice issues.
